2. Exclusive Titles & Pricing

Xbox One X
Bluehole Studio

Several new Xbox-exclusive titles were announced during Microsoft's E3 press conference, all of which were being shown off using the technology of the Xbox One X to render in "True 4K".

These titles included a sequel to Undead Labs' Xbox-exclusive State of Decay, multiplayer pirate-em-up Sea of Thieves and a look at Crackdown 3.

Microsoft also announced an Xbox-exclusive console release of Player Unknown's Battlegrounds, and showed off some seriously impressive visuals and gameplay with a trailer for Forza Motorsport 7.

Showing off these titles immediately following the Xbox One X's announcement is a good move, as it shows those who are considering a jump from a certain competitor's console to the Microsoft brand that there are exclusive titles for them to get their hands on alongside their new console.

Microsoft finished up the conference by revealing a price point for the Xbox One X, retailing in the US at $499.
